I have a one suggestion. I know this patch came from David's OOM problem a few days ago. I think total pages isolated of all lru doesn't help us much. It just represents why [in]active[anon/file] is zero. How about adding isolate page number per each lru ? IsolatedPages(file) IsolatedPages(anon) It can help knowing exact number of each lru. --=20 Kind regards, Minchan Kim -- To unsubscribe, send a message with 'unsubscribe linux-mm' in the body to majordomo@kvack.org.
